THORAD AGENA D DEB, 4682 is space debris in SSO originally from a launch on Wed, 08 Apr 1970 UTC launched from the Air Force Western Test Range (AFWTR). Debris objects in space refer to the collection of defunct objects orbiting the Earth. Examples of debris include non-operational satellites, rocket bodies, and fragments generated from explosions, collisions, or faulty payload assembly.
